Analysis

Burkina Faso recorded 0.0014 Mt CO2e for methane (ch4) emissions from power industry (energy) in 2024.

That represents a change of up 7.7% on the previous year and up 40.0% over ten years.

Over the whole period, methane (ch4) emissions from power industry (energy) in Burkina Faso peaked at 0.0015 Mt CO2e in 2018 and was at its lowest, 0 Mt CO2e, in 1970.

That places Burkina Faso 128th out of 194 countries with data for 2024, putting it in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from electricity and heat generation (subsector of the energy sector) including IPCC 2006 code 1.A.1.a.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
